I thought we worked the ball better on counter-attacks instead of just playing it long down the side and hope someone ran onto it.
But there were still problems. The midfield of Henderson, Lingard and Alli was ineffective in possession and caved to any sort of pressure from Spain. The final pass in the final third was often rushed or overhit. Kane was a ghost. Shaw, for all his influence going forward, was a mess when he had any defending to do.
We also had problems with quick switches of play, just as we did vs Croatia. This shape isn't providing enough cover on the flanks against good possession sides and I hope Southgate considers changing to a 3-4-3 against them.
